i would call your local MS society and ask for a list of their referring drs.
then see if an MS specialist is on it.
some drs will grant you a 15" get acquainted appt. worth asking about.
i live in denver and see an MS specialist here.
another neuro was also highly recommended to me and i saw him thinking i might have to switch. it was a good visit and he said he'd take me as a pt but also said my dr had more experience with MS than he did.
calling local hosp's was also a good idea.
asking your pcp for a referral might give you some info.
calling your local teaching hospital might yield some info but i generally don't like teaching hosp's for care. underlings docs do the care and they're not experienced, nor can they always have good bedside manners.
if you know any nurses ask them as they're a gold mine of great info. they have the inside scoop.
